Defiance (1980) carries a gritty vibe that's unmistakable. Set in a seedy New York neighborhood, it immerses you in the chaos of gang violence. Tommy, our lead, arrives hoping for a quiet stint before heading back to sea, but that's not how the streets work. The pacing keeps you on edge; it’s relentless as he navigates turf wars with the Souls gang. The practical effects, while not overblown, pack a punch during the fight scenes. Performances lean towards the raw side, giving that authentic feel. What makes it distinctive? It's the way it explores themes of survival and community amidst violence. It's not just a battle; it's a clash of wills in a desperate urban reality.
